What Are Autonomous Vacuum Robots?

Autonomous vacuum robotics, frequently described as robotic vacuums or robovacs, are smart cleaning gadgets that operate without human intervention. Geared up with advanced sensors, mapping innovation, and AI algorithms, these robots can browse through a home, recognize and clean dirt and particles, and go back to their charging dock when the battery is low. They are designed to preserve a constant level of tidiness in numerous environments, including hardwood floors, carpets, and tiles.

Key Features and Technologies

  1. Mapping and Navigation

    • Laser Mapping (LIDAR): Many high-end robovacs use LIDAR technology to develop a detailed map of the home. This allows the robot to navigate effectively, avoiding challenges and covering every inch of the floor.
    • Visual Simultaneous Localization and Mapping (vSLAM): Similar to LIDAR, vSLAM utilizes video cameras and image processing to map and navigate the home. This innovation is often more budget friendly and similarly reliable in many circumstances.
  2. Sensing Units and Obstacle Avoidance

    • Bump Sensors: These sensors identify when the robot has bumped into a things, permitting it to change instructions to avoid additional crashes.
    • Cliff Sensors: These sensing units prevent the robot from falling off stairs or other raised surfaces by identifying sharp drops.
    • Dust Detection: Some designs are equipped with sensors that can discover dirt and particles, permitting the robot to concentrate on areas that need more cleaning.
  3. Cleaning Performance

    • Brush Systems: Robovacs feature numerous brush configurations, consisting of side brushes and main brushes, to effectively tidy different surface areas.
    • Suction Power: The suction power of a robovac is essential for its cleaning effectiveness. Higher suction power is normally required for carpets and pet hair.
    • Filter Systems: Most designs have HEPA filters to trap fine particles and improve indoor air quality.
  4. Connectivity and Control

    • Wi-Fi Integration: Many robovacs can be controlled via a mobile phone app, allowing users to set up cleanings, screen progress, and receive signals.
    • Voice Assistants: Compatibility with voice assistants like Amazon Alexa and Google Assistant adds another layer of benefit, making it possible for users to start or stop cleaning with easy voice commands.

Frequently Asked Questions About Autonomous Vacuum Robots

Q: Are autonomous vacuum robots ideal for homes with animals?

  • A: Yes, lots of robovacs are created to handle pet hair and dander. Models with strong suction power and specialized brush systems are especially reliable for pet owners.

Q: How often should I clean my robovac?

  • A: It is advised to clean up the brushes, filters, and dustbin after each use to guarantee optimum efficiency. Furthermore, routine deep cleaning of the robot's elements can assist maintain its efficiency.

Q: Can robovacs clean stairs?

  • A: Most robovacs are developed to tidy flat surfaces and will avoid stairs due to cliff sensing units. Nevertheless, some designs can browsing single steps and even whole staircases, though this is less common.

Q: Are robovacs loud?

  • A: Most robovacs are developed to run quietly, but the sound level can differ depending on the model and suction power. Some models provide a "quiet mode" for minimal disruption.

Q: Can robovacs replace a traditional vacuum?

  • A: While robovacs are exceptional for preserving day-to-day tidiness, they may not be as effective as conventional vacuum cleaners for deep cleaning or handling large quantities of dirt and particles. However, they can considerably lower the frequency of manual cleaning.

Maintenance and Troubleshooting

  1. Routine Cleaning

    • Tidy the brushes, filters, and dustbin after each usage to prevent blocking and preserve efficiency.
  2. Check for Obstacles

    • Ensure that the robot's course is free of obstacles like small things, cables, and furnishings. This can assist prevent the robot from getting stuck or harmed.
  3. Software Updates

    • Keep the robot vacuum cleaner best's software application as much as date to gain from the current functions and improvements.
  4. Common Issues and Solutions

    • Robot Gets Stuck: Clear the area of obstacles and check for any twisted cords or particles in the brushes.
    • Low Battery: Ensure the robot is returning to its charging dock and that the dock is functioning appropriately.
    • Dirty Filters: Replace or clean up the filters as recommended by the maker.
